Yes, as noted in site news and on the GoldToken Group at http://groups.msn.com/Goldtoken-com/, something is being done about it. Chad is currently writing script that will help block this type of DOS Attack, eliminating moduals that were being directly attacked, scheduling the loading of lighttpd (a lighter weight web server that is becoming very popular and less vulnerable than Apache), and we are banning the IP's involved. Already, it has made a huge difference. Yahoo has also been under attack the last few weeks and is having much the same troubles. It is not uncommon for any large site to have to deal with server attacks. The trouble with the current attack is it was not a type that we were used to and had already taken measures against. Just like a virus, there are new types out all the time. At first, not even our hosting company recognized what it was. In fact, they have been working diligently with us to resolve the issues and were the ones to notify me late this week that it was a new type of DOS Attack.
